```
"http://localhost:8888"
"http://localhost:8888/"
"http://127.0.0.1:8888"
"http://127.0.0.1:8888/"
"8888"
8888
```

Ideally these should converge to the same thing.  Since many hash
tables are keyed off `url-or-port`, forgetting to
normalize `url-or-port` with `ein:url` leads to missed cache hits and
general malaise.  So we try to do that.

(eval-when-compile (require 'cl))
(require 'ert)
(require 'ein) ; for `ein:version'
(require 'ein-utils)
(ert-deftest ein-url-simple ()
(should (null (ein:url nil)))
(should (equal (ein:url 8888) "http://127.0.0.1:8888"))
(should (equal (ein:url "http://localhost") "http://127.0.0.1"))
(should (equal (ein:url "https://localhost:8888") "https://127.0.0.1:8888"))
(loop for url in '("http://127.0.0.1:8888" "http://localhost:8888" "http://127.0.0.1:8888/" "http://localhost:8888/" "8888" 8888)
do (should (equal (ein:url "http://localhost:8888") (ein:url url)))))
(ert-deftest ein-url-slashes ()
(loop for a in '("a" "a/" "/a")
do (loop for b in '("b" "/b")
do (should (equal (ein:url 8888 a b)
"http://127.0.0.1:8888/a/b")))
do (should (equal (ein:url 8888 a "b/")
"http://127.0.0.1:8888/a/b"))))
(ert-deftest ein-trim-simple ()
(should (equal (ein:trim "a") "a"))
(should (equal (ein:trim " a ") "a"))
(should (equal (ein:trim "\na\n") "a")))
(ert-deftest ein-trim-middle-spaces ()
(should (equal (ein:trim "a b") "a b"))
(should (equal (ein:trim " a b ") "a b"))
(should (equal (ein:trim "\na b\n") "a b")))
(ert-deftest ein-trim-left-simple ()
(should (equal (ein:trim-left "a") "a"))
(should (equal (ein:trim-left " a ") "a "))
(should (equal (ein:trim-left "\na\n") "a\n")))
(ert-deftest ein-trim-right-simple ()
(should (equal (ein:trim-right "a") "a"))
(should (equal (ein:trim-right " a ") " a"))
(should (equal (ein:trim-right "\na\n") "\na")))
